Trigger.dev Basic Tasks (v4)

MUST use @trigger.dev/sdk (v4), NEVER client.defineJob

Basic Task

import { task } from "@trigger.dev/sdk";

export const processData = task({
  id: "process-data",
  retry: {
    maxAttempts: 10,
    factor: 1.8,
    minTimeoutInMs: 500,
    maxTimeoutInMs: 30_000,
    randomize: false,
  },
  run: async (payload: { userId: string; data: any[] }) => {
    // Task logic - runs for long time, no timeouts
    console.log(`Processing ${payload.data.length} items for user ${payload.userId}`);
    return { processed: payload.data.length };
  },
});

Schema Task (with validation)

import { schemaTask } from "@trigger.dev/sdk";
import { z } from "zod";

export const validatedTask = schemaTask({
  id: "validated-task",
  schema: z.object({
    name: z.string(),
    age: z.number(),
    email: z.string().email(),
  }),
  run: async (payload) => {
    // Payload is automatically validated and typed
    return { message: `Hello ${payload.name}, age ${payload.age}` };
  },
});

Scheduled Task

import { schedules } from "@trigger.dev/sdk";

const dailyReport = schedules.task({
  id: "daily-report",
  cron: "0 9 * * *", // Daily at 9:00 AM UTC
  // or with timezone: cron: { pattern: "0 9 * * *", timezone: "America/New_York" },
  run: async (payload) => {
    console.log("Scheduled run at:", payload.timestamp);
    console.log("Last run was:", payload.lastTimestamp);
    console.log("Next 5 runs:", payload.upcoming);

    // Generate daily report logic
    return { reportGenerated: true, date: payload.timestamp };
  },
});

Triggering Tasks

From Backend Code

import { tasks } from "@trigger.dev/sdk";
import type { processData } from "./trigger/tasks";

// Single trigger
const handle = await tasks.trigger<typeof processData>("process-data", {
  userId: "123",
  data: [{ id: 1 }, { id: 2 }],
});

// Batch trigger
const batchHandle = await tasks.batchTrigger<typeof processData>("process-data", [
  { payload: { userId: "123", data: [{ id: 1 }] } },
  { payload: { userId: "456", data: [{ id: 2 }] } },
]);

From Inside Tasks (with Result handling)

export const parentTask = task({
  id: "parent-task",
  run: async (payload) => {
    // Trigger and continue
    const handle = await childTask.trigger({ data: "value" });

    // Trigger and wait - returns Result object, NOT task output
    const result = await childTask.triggerAndWait({ data: "value" });
    if (result.ok) {
      console.log("Task output:", result.output); // Actual task return value
    } else {
      console.error("Task failed:", result.error);
    }

    // Quick unwrap (throws on error)
    const output = await childTask.triggerAndWait({ data: "value" }).unwrap();

    // Batch trigger and wait
    const results = await childTask.batchTriggerAndWait([
      { payload: { data: "item1" } },
      { payload: { data: "item2" } },
    ]);

    for (const run of results) {
      if (run.ok) {
        console.log("Success:", run.output);
      } else {
        console.log("Failed:", run.error);
      }
    }
  },
});

export const childTask = task({
  id: "child-task",
  run: async (payload: { data: string }) => {
    return { processed: payload.data };
  },
});

Never wrap triggerAndWait or batchTriggerAndWait calls in a Promise.all or Promise.allSettled as this is not supported in Trigger.dev tasks.

Waits

import { task, wait } from "@trigger.dev/sdk";

export const taskWithWaits = task({
  id: "task-with-waits",
  run: async (payload) => {
    console.log("Starting task");

    // Wait for specific duration
    await wait.for({ seconds: 30 });
    await wait.for({ minutes: 5 });
    await wait.for({ hours: 1 });
    await wait.for({ days: 1 });

    // Wait until a future date
    await wait.until({ date: new Date(Date.now() + 24 * 60 * 60 * 1000) });

    // Wait for token (from external system)
    await wait.forToken({
      token: "user-approval-token",
      timeoutInSeconds: 3600, // 1 hour timeout
    });

    console.log("All waits completed");
    return { status: "completed" };
  },
});

Never wrap wait calls in a Promise.all or Promise.allSettled as this is not supported in Trigger.dev tasks.

Key Points

  • Result vs Output: triggerAndWait() returns a Result object with ok, output, error properties - NOT the direct task output
  • Type safety: Use import type for task references when triggering from backend
  • Waits > 5 seconds: Automatically checkpointed, don't count toward compute usage

NEVER Use (v2 deprecated)

// BREAKS APPLICATION
client.defineJob({
  id: "job-id",
  run: async (payload, io) => {
    /* ... */
  },
});

Use v4 SDK (@trigger.dev/sdk), check result.ok before accessing result.output
